Confirm a Reservation (For Travellers)

Dear Sir,

This letter is to confirm my registration at the Springfield History Association's annual convention on January 25, 2002.

I have enclosed my check for $250.00, as you requested. I remind you that I have yet to receive my information packet. As the day of the convention is rapidly approaching, could you please express mail the packet and confirmation of my registration to the address above?

I appreciate your help and look forward to attending the convention.

Best Regards,
[Your Name]

Cancel a Reservation

Dear Sir,

My company scheduled the Lincoln room at your hotel for a banquet on May 5. I apologize, but I must cancel the arrangements. This morning's headlines tell the reason: Doe International just bought us.

Please refund my $500 deposit and accept my sincere regrets. Maybe we can try again once the dust settles.

Best Regards,
[Your Name]
